Playa Adds New Cancun Resort to Management Portfolio

Playa Hotels & Resorts has announced its management role of Seadust Cancun Family Resort in Cancun, Mexico. The seventh managed property for the company, Playa will lead all operations, sales and marketing of the resort, and join the company’s portfolio of 23 properties across Mexico and the Caribbean.

Located along the white sand beaches on the southern Cancun Hotel Zone, the 502-room resort has 19 restaurants, lounges and bars, a fitness center and a full-service holistic spa. Rooms offer views either of the Atlantic or the Nichupté Lagoon.

Guests can enjoy the Treasure Island Water Park which includes slides, a pirate ship, water games and more. For the adults, there is an exclusive Club Caribe swimming pool in addition to one infinity pool, one kid's pool and a baby pool.
